NEW PALTZ – Police in New Paltz arrested a man who was reported to have been found in a residence while armed with a knife.
William Carr, 30, of New Paltz, was found just before 6 a.m. on December 23 and charged with menacing, petit larceny and unlawful possession of marijuana.
Police had been called to the residence at 5:15 a.m. for a report of an unwanted man in the residence who was armed with a knife.
The man, who was known to the victim, fled before officers arrived, but he was identified and located a short distance away where he was found in possession of the knife.
Carr was sent to the Ulster County Jail in lieu of $5,000 cash bail or $10,000 bond.
New Paltz Police were assisted by State Police, the Ulster County Sheriff’s Office, and SUNY New Paltz Police.
